The Corey Curse
The Corey Curse stands as a defining track on Evergrey's 1999 album Solitude, Dominance, Tragedy, capturing the band's early mastery of progressive metal. Recorded during a formative period for the Swedish group, the song showcases their signature blend of heavy instrumentation and intricate songwriting that would come to define their discography. As part of an era marked by intense thematic exploration, the recording reflects the band's commitment to complex arrangements and powerful vocal delivery. This work remains a significant song in their catalogue, illustrating the musical direction that established their reputation within the genre. Fans and critics alike recognize the track for its contribution to the album's cohesive narrative and its demonstration of the band's evolving sound during the late nineties. |
